Item8.01 Other Events


ExchangeOffer and Consent Solicitation

On October 2, 2025, Getty Images, Inc. (the “Issuer”), an indirect wholly owned subsidiary of Getty Images Holdings, Inc. (the “Company”), issued a press release announcing the early results of the previously announced offer by the Issuer to exchange (the “Exchange Offer”) any and all of the Issuer’s issued and outstanding unsecured 9.750% Senior Notes due 2027 (the “Old Notes”) for newly issued unsecured 14.000% Senior Notes due 2028 (the “New Notes”) of the Issuer and the related solicitation of consents (the “Consent Solicitation”) to certain proposed amendments to the terms of the indenture governing the Old Notes.

According to Accuratus Tax and CA Services LLC, using the commercial names “Bondholder Communications Group” or “BondCom”, the information and exchange agent for the Exchange Offer and Consent Solicitation, as of 5:00 p.m., New York City time, on October 1, 2025, representing the Early Tender Time and Withdrawal Deadline for the Exchange Offer and Consent Solicitation, $294,665,000 aggregate principal amount of Old Notes had been validly tendered (and not validly withdrawn) in the Exchange Offer, representing 98.22% of the outstanding principal amount of Old Notes (and consents thereby deemed validly given and not validly revoked in the Consent Solicitation).


Further, the Issuer announced that the requisite consents (the “Requisite Consents”) to adopt the proposed amendments (the “Proposed Amendments”) described in the Offering Memorandum (as defined below) to the indenture governing the Old Notes (as supplemented by the first and second supplemental indentures thereto the “Old Notes Indenture”) have been received. As a result, the Issuer, Wilmington Trust, National Association, in its capacity as trustee under the Old Notes Indenture and each of the guarantors party thereto will promptly enter into a third supplemental indenture to the Old Notes Indenture containing the Proposed Amendments.

The supplemental indenture containing the Proposed Amendments will be effective upon execution by the parties thereto but will not become operative unless and until the Old Notes that are validly tendered (and not validly withdrawn) by Eligible Holders (as defined in the confidential offering memorandum and consent solicitation statement, dated September 18, 2025 (the “Offering Memorandum”)) have been accepted for exchange and paid for by the Issuer in accordance with the terms of the Exchange Offer and Consent Solicitation. We expect to settle the Exchange Offer and issue the New Notes on October 21, 2025.

SeniorSecured Notes Offering


On October 6, 2025, the Issuer issued a press release announcing that it priced a private offering of $628,400,000 aggregate principal amount of the Issuer’s 10.500% senior secured notes due 2030 (the “Notes”). The Notes will be senior secured obligations of the Issuer and will be jointly and severally guaranteed on a senior secured first lien basis by the same guarantors that provide guarantees for the Issuer’s outstanding 11.250% Senior Secured Notes due 2030 and its secured credit facility. The offering of the Notes is expected to close on or around October 21, 2025, subject to customary closing conditions.

The offering of the Notes is being made in connection with the Company’s previously announced proposed merger of equals (the “Merger”) with Shutterstock, Inc. (“Shutterstock”), creating a premier visual company. An amount equal to the gross proceeds from the sale of the Notes will be deposited in an escrow account and will be secured by a first-priority security interest in the escrow account and all funds deposited therein. Upon release from escrow, the Company and the Issuer intend to use the net proceeds from the offering of the Notes to pay cash consideration to holders of Shutterstock common stock in connection with the Merger, to refinance Shutterstock indebtedness, as well as associated fees and expenses.

If the agreement to complete the Merger is terminated, or the Merger is not consummated on or prior to October 6, 2026, or if the Issuer informs U.S. Bank National Association, in its capacity as escrow agent for the proceeds of the offering, that it reasonably believes the Merger will not be consummated on or prior to October 6, 2026, the Notes will be redeemed in accordance with a special mandatory redemption at a redemption price equal to 100% of the issue price of the Notes, plus accrued and unpaid interest, if any, from the date of issuance or the most recent date to which interest has been paid or provided for, to, but not including, the date of such redemption.

Getty Images Announces Successful Results of Early Participationin Exchange Offer and Consent Solicitation


NEW YORK, October 2,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) – Getty Images Holdings, Inc. (NYSE: GETY) (“Getty Images”) announced today the early results of the previously announced offer by Getty Images, Inc. (the “Issuer”), an indirect wholly owned subsidiary of Getty Images, to exchange (the “Exchange Offer”) any and all of the Issuer’s issued and outstanding unsecured 9.750% Senior Notes due 2027 (the “Old Notes”) for newly issued unsecured 14.000% Senior Notes due 2028 (the “New Notes”) of the Issuer and the related solicitation of consents (the “Consent Solicitation”) to certain proposed amendments to the terms of the indenture governing the Old Notes. The Exchange Offer and Consent Solicitation have been made pursuant to the terms of and subject to the conditions set forth in a confidential Offering Memorandum and Consent Solicitation Statement, dated September 18, 2025 (the “Offering Memorandum”).

Further, the Issuer announced today that the requisite consents (the “Requisite Consents”) to adopt the proposed amendments (the “Proposed Amendments”) described in the Offering Memorandum to the indenture governing the Old Notes (as supplemented by the first and second supplemental indentures thereto the “Old Notes Indenture”) have been received. As a result, the Issuer, Wilmington Trust, National Association, in its capacity as trustee under the Old Notes Indenture and each of the guarantors party thereto will promptly enter into a third supplemental indenture to the Old Notes Indenture containing the Proposed Amendments.

The supplemental indenture containing the Proposed Amendments will be effective upon execution by the parties thereto but will not become operative unless and until the Old Notes that are validly tendered (and not validly withdrawn) by Eligible Holders (as defined in the Offering Memorandum) have been accepted for exchange and paid for by the Issuer in accordance with the terms of the Exchange Offer and Consent Solicitation.

Eligible Holders of Old Notes may not deliver consents to the Proposed Amendments in the Consent Solicitation without tendering Old Notes in the Exchange Offer, and may not tender Old Notes in the Exchange Offer without delivering consents to the Proposed Amendments in the Consent Solicitation. The consent results are based on valid tenders of Old Notes by Eligible Holders thereof, which are deemed also to constitute the delivery of consents in the Consent Solicitation made by the Issuer to adopt the Proposed Amendments.

According to Accuratus Tax and CA Services LLC, using the commercial names “Bondholder Communications Group” or “BondCom”, the information and exchange agent for the Exchange Offer and Consent Solicitation (the “Information and Exchange Agent”), as of 5:00 p.m., New York City time, on October 1, 2025 (the “Early Tender Time” and the “Withdrawal Deadline”), the principal amount of Old Notes set forth in the table below had been validly tendered and not validly withdrawn (and consents thereby deemed validly given and not validly revoked) in the Exchange Offer and the Consent Solicitation:

Title of Series (Old Notes) CUSIP / ISIN Nos. of Old Notes Aggregate Principal<br> Amount Outstanding Old Notes Tendered and Consents Delivered<br> at Early Tender Time
Principal Amount Percentage
9.750% Senior Notes due 2027 144A CUSIP: 374276AJ2<br> 144A ISIN: US374276AJ21<br> Reg S CUSIP: U3742LAA5<br> Reg S ISIN: USU3742LAA53 $ 300,000,000 $ 294,665,000 98.22 %

Eligible Holders that validly tendered (and did not validly withdraw) their Old Notes in the Exchange Offer, and validly delivered (and did not validly revoke) the related consents to the Proposed Amendments in the Consent Solicitation at or prior to the Early Tender Time and the Withdrawal Deadline, as applicable, and whose Old Notes are accepted for exchange by the Issuer, will be entitled to receive the Total Consideration (as defined in the Offering Memorandum) and accrued and unpaid interest from the last interest payment date to, but not including, the settlement date of the Exchange Offer, for their Old Notes that were validly tendered (and not validly withdrawn) in the Exchange Offer and accepted for exchange by the Issuer, subject to the terms and conditions contained in the Offering Memorandum. The Total Consideration consists of $1,000 principal amount of New Notes, which includes an Early Tender Premium of $50 principal amount of New Notes, per $1,000 principal amount of Old Notes tendered (and not validly withdrawn) in the Exchange Offer and accepted for exchange by the Issuer. The Total Consideration will be paid in New Notes and the accrued and unpaid interest will be paid in cash by the Issuer on the settlement date of the Exchange Offer. We expect to settle the Exchange Offer and issue the New Notes on October 21, 2025.

About Getty Images


Getty Images (NYSE: GETY) is a preeminent global visual content creator and marketplace that offers a full range of content solutions to meet the needs of any customer around the globe, no matter their size. Through its Getty Images, iStock and Unsplash brands, websites and APIs, Getty Images serves customers in almost every country in the world and is the first-place people turn to discover, purchase and share powerful visual content from the world’s best photographers and videographers. Getty Images works with almost 600,000 content creators and more than 355 content partners to deliver this powerful and comprehensive content. Each year Getty Images covers more than 160,000 news, sport and entertainment events providing depth and breadth of coverage that is unmatched. Getty Images maintains one of the largest and best privately-owned photographic archives in the world with millions of images dating back to the beginning of photography.

Through its best-in-class creative library and Custom Content solutions, Getty Images helps customers elevate their creativity and entire end-to-end creative process to find the right visual for any need. With the adoption and distribution of generative AI technologies and tools trained on permissioned content that include indemnification and perpetual, worldwide usage rights, Getty Images and iStock customers can use text to image generation to ideate and create commercially safe compelling visuals, further expanding Getty Images capabilities to deliver exactly what customers are looking for.
